{"product_id":"indentation-techniques-in-ceramic-materials-characterization-isbn-9781574982121","title":"Indentation Techniques in Ceramic Materials Characterization","description":"Indentation techniques have become widely used in the characterization of brittle solids due to their simplicity, cost effectiveness, rapidness, and maybe most importantly, the indenter itself can be used as a mechanical microprobe in thin films, interfaces, grain boundaries, and nanocomposites. The papers in these proceedings cover measurement techniques, reliability of, and problems associated with this testing method.
